I've spent years hauling rigs through the Old Fourth Ward and navigating the tight alleys of Kerrytown. When a drain overflows, your first instinct is a plumber, but that changes if you're managing a job site or a festival. Plumbers handle the permanent pipes inside those post-2000 infill buildings. We handle the mobile infrastructure. If your standard construction unit is full, a plumber won't touch it because they aren't set up for waste hauling. Our crew focuses on the containment side of things. We've seen folks try a diy composting vs chemical setup only to realize they need professional extraction. We bring the vacuum trucks to Oxbridge sites to keep things moving. If the water is coming out of the floor of a house, call the plumber. If your luxury restroom trailer has a sensor light on, that's our job. We understand the specific septic pumping vs rental distinctions that keep Ann Arbor clean.
